ID number: BIRBI-R1715 Object type: Coin
Institution: The Barber Institute of Fine Arts Named collection: G. Haines Collection Collector: Haines, Geoffrey Maker: Philip I; Rome Denomination: Sestertius Place made: Rome Culture: Roman Date made: 248 Metal: Base metal Diameter (cm): 2.95 Weight (g): 17.11 Axis (degrees): 0.00 Provenance: Haines 1445. W. S. Lincoln, 1932. |

|
Description: Obverse: Head of Philip, wearing laurel wreath, draped and cuirassed, facing r. Reverse: Goat, walking l.
Inscriptions: Obverse: 'ΠΠP M IVL PHILIPPVS ΠΠG (Imperator Marcus Julius Philip Augustus). Reverse: SIECVLAΠES ΛVGG (Secular Games of the Emperors). In Exergue: S C (Translation Disputed).
Bibliography: RIC IV 264 (Philip I)
